导航
当前位置:首页>>app
在线生成app,封装app

android电商app开发定制

2023-11-03 围观 : 3次

在移动互联网时代,许多企业都开始向电商领域布局,为了更好地满足用户的需求和提高自身竞争力,开发一款适合自己企业的电商app变得越来越必要。本文将介绍android电商app的开发定制。

1.需求分析

在开发电商app之前,需要进行充分的需求分析。需要明确产品的目标用户、核心功能、外观设计等等。同时,还需要考虑如何优化用户体验,提高用户留存率。因此,在需求分析的过程中,需要充分了解目标用户的需求,进而确定产品设计方向。

2.技术架构

在技术选择上,我们可以采用MVC、MVP或MVVM等框架,以及使用第三方开源工具和库。这些技术和工具可以提高开发效率和产品性能,并且让我们更好地实现一些复杂功能,如支付、物流查询等等。

3.用户界面设计

界面设计是app的重要组成部分,决定着用户是否喜欢使用你的app。所以在设计时,需要注意色彩搭配、字体选择、布局设计等方面。根据产品的目标用户和定位确定概念及风格,构建整个app外观。合理的UI设计能够提高用户体验,增加用户留存率。

4.功能模块开发

电商app的功能模块包括商品管理、购物车、下订单、支付、物流查询、客服及用户中心等。每个功能模块都需要我们定义接口、实现逻辑,再通过集成第三方工具进行兼容。比如PayPal支付、丰富和完善的物流查询、优秀的客服系统等等,这些都需要我们进行精确的对接。

5.安全性保障

安全是电商app开发工作的重要内容之一。通过实现一些必要的措施保证用户的交易安全和隐私不被泄露,如数据加密、防恶意攻击等。有效的安全保护能够有效提高用户的信任感,为公司赢得良好的口碑。

6.测试和发布

app开发完成后,需要进行系统测试、功能测试和性能测试。 进行冒烟测试和黑盒测试等,尽可能排除所有可能的问题,保证app的质量。测试结束后,需要进行版本发布到对应的应用商店。除此之外,对于每个版本需要进行更新或修复等操作,用户交流和反馈也是关键之一。

总的来说,电商app的开发需要经过详细的需求分析和技术架构设计,才能确保产品的可行性和在用户群体中获得青睐。同时,为了保证产品的质量,需要在进行每个模块的功能实现时尽力保证产品的稳健性。在app发布后,需要不断积极地与用户沟通交流,根据用户的反馈进行改进,不断提高产品的质量和用户使用体验,从而更好地满足用户需求,促进企业发展。

相关文章
  • m1s安卓开发

    M1S是一款基于ARM Cortex-A53架构的开发板,支持安卓系统开发。其主要组成部分包括CPU、RAM、存储芯片、输入输出接口等。简单来说,安卓开发就是通过开发工具对系统进行编程,实现各种应用程序的开发与功能扩展。M1S采用ARM64架构,因此首先需要配置安卓开发环境。在安装完毕并配置好环境之...

    2023-11-08
  • eclipse安卓开发备忘录

    Eclipse是一款免费的Java开源集成开发环境(IDE),它被广泛应用于各种软件开发领域。其中,Android Studio是基于Eclipse的Android开发工具,Android Studio的出现使得开发Android应用变得更为容易和高效。下面介绍一些Eclipse安卓开发的备忘事项:...

    2023-11-04
  • 怎样建起一个app

    建立一个应用程序(app)需要一些基本的知识和技能,但是它并不是一件难事。在本文中,我们将介绍建立一个应用程序的基本原理和步骤。1. 确定目标和需求在开始建立应用程序之前,你需要明确你的目标和需求。你需要思考你的应用程序要解决什么问题,它是为哪种用户设计的,它需要哪些特定的功能等等。这些问题的答案将...

    2023-10-17
  • labview安卓开发实例

    LabVIEW是一种基于图形化编程的交互式开发环境,它可以帮助开发者更加直观地创建和设计各种应用程序。LabVIEW支持多种编程语言,如C,C++,Java等等。在移动设备开发领域,LabVIEW也有很广泛的应用,特别是在安卓开发领域,它能够简化安卓应用程序的开发过程,提高开发效率。下面将介绍一个简...

    2023-11-08
  • 打包内嵌浏览器的exe文件

    在软件开发中,有时需要将浏览器嵌入到应用程序中,以便向用户提供更好的用户体验。这种应用程序通常被称为内嵌浏览器或浏览器控件。内嵌浏览器可以让应用程序在不离开应用程序的情况下访问互联网,同时还可以在应用程序中显示网页、在线内容和其他网络资源。内嵌浏览器通常是通过打包程序来实现的。打包程序是一种将应用程...

    2023-11-18